Subject: Make gdk_visual_get_*_pixel_details work again
These functions are supposed to return the numbers of consecutive
1 bits in each components mask as precision. However, due to a
copy-paste mistake when this code was moved around in
commit 70d689cddda0dc616af97e8ed047d0c0acf7c7a6, the precision
was always reported as zero. This affects only a few applications
that directly set window background on X11 windows, such as emacs.
